New Delhi: Superstar Shah Rukh Khan's wife Gauri today refused to answer questions about her family's driver being arrested for allegedly raping a minor maid. 
 
The 43-year-old producer-interior designer along with her son Aryan and daughter Suhana, was in the capital to inaugurate a bakery shop 'The Brown Box' of her cousin Priyanka Tiwari. 
 
This was Gauri's first public appearance since the case came to light. 
 
"I will not answer any personal questions. I am here for my sister's bakery launch and will only speak about that. I am here to bless her and share her joy with her as it was her dream to open her own bakery store one day and I am happy to be a part of the day," she told reporters here. 
 
"If I will talk about my own things then the focus would be shifted from her (Priyanka). And I don't want that to happen," the mother of three said. 
 
Dressed in blue denims teamed with a white top, Gauri said it has always been a bliss to visit her hometown. 
 
"I am from Delhi and I spent all my childhood and teenage here. It feels great to be here as my parents are in Delhi," she said. 
 
On June 25, Mumbai police arrested Shah Rukh's driver for allegedly raping the minor girl, who worked as a help at a former actress' house.
